Add a warning regarding localhost-only listening daemons inside jails.

Apparently binding only to 127.0.0.1 inside of a jail actually binds
to the jail IP address as well (in effect, bind to all available
interfaces in the jail).

@ -11,11 +11,12 @@ default) holds the mail if an MTA can not be contacted.
To accomplish this, under the default setup, an MTA must be listening on
localhost port 25. If the rc.conf sendmail_enable option is set to "NO",
a sendmail daemon will still be started and bound only to the localhost
interface in order to accept command line submitted mail. If this is not
a desirable solution, it can be disabled using the sendmail_submit_enable
rc.conf option. However, if both sendmail_enable and sendmail_submit_enable
are set to "NO", you must do one of two things for command line submitted
mail:
